Abstract

ABSTRACT The carbon and oxygen stable isotope composition of wood cellulose (δ13Ccellulose and δ18O cellulose, respectively) reveal well-defined seasonal variations that contain valuable records of past climate, leaf gas exchange and carbon allocation d
